What is the best flooring for Seattle's wet climate?

LVP (Luxury Vinyl Plank) is the most moisture-resistant option and ideal for Seattle basements, kitchens, and bathrooms. Engineered hardwood is also a good choice where you want a wood look with better dimensional stability than solid hardwood in humid conditions.

Is LVP waterproof, and is it better than laminate?

Yes — quality LVP is 100% waterproof, whereas laminate is only water-resistant and will swell if water sits on seams. LVP also tends to be more comfortable underfoot and quieter. For Seattle homes with moisture concerns, LVP is the better long-term choice.

When should I refinish my hardwood floors instead of replacing them?

If the boards are structurally sound — no rot, warping, or deep gouges that go through the top layer — refinishing is almost always the better value. It restores like-new appearance at roughly 25–40% of replacement cost. We assess this during the free estimate.

How long does hardwood floor refinishing take?

A typical room takes 2–3 days: one day for sanding and prep, one for staining and sealing, and one for final coats to cure. You'll want to stay off the floors for 24 hours after the last coat. For most Seattle homes, the full job is done in under a week.

Can carpet be repaired, or does it always need full replacement?

Many carpet problems — pet damage, snags, small burns, seam separation — can be patched or re-stretched without replacing the entire floor. Patches are nearly invisible when done with matching material. We'll tell you honestly whether a repair makes sense or if replacement is the better call.
